#64521d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#64521d is composed of 39.2% red, 32.2% green and 11.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 18% magenta, 71% yellow and 60.8% black. It has a hue angle of 44.8 degrees, a saturation of 55% and a lightness of 25.3%. #64521d color hex could be obtained by blending #c8a43a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

#64521d color description : Very dark orange [Brown tone].

#64521d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#64521d has RGB values of R:100, G:82, B:29 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.18, Y:0.71, K:0.61. Its decimal value is 6574621.

Hex triplet 64521d #64521d
RGB Decimal 100, 82, 29 rgb(100,82,29)
RGB Percent 39.2, 32.2, 11.4 rgb(39.2%,32.2%,11.4%)
CMYK 0, 18, 71, 61
HSL 44.8°, 55, 25.3 hsl(44.8,55%,25.3%)
HSV (or HSB) 44.8°, 71, 39.2
Web Safe 666633 #666633
CIE-LAB 35.661, 0.874, 32.84
XYZ 8.495, 8.833, 2.42
xyY 0.43, 0.447, 8.833
CIE-LCH 35.661, 32.851, 88.476
CIE-LUV 35.661, 14.539, 31.479
Hunter-Lab 29.72, -0.992, 15.977
Binary 01100100, 01010010, 00011101

Shades and Tints of #64521d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090703 is the darkest color, while #fdfcf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#64521d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#414140 is the less saturated color, while #7d5e04 is the most saturated one.
